AUG 31, 203 (newstodate): Taiwanese carrier, Eva Air plans to set up a cargo center in Brussels to cope with increasing demand in the market.
The airlines, which operates six freighter flights into Brussels, also plans to add a seventh frequency in October.
During the first six months of the year, the airline's Europe-bound cargo volumes, primarily electronics, grew by seven percent, and the airline expects to see a 10 percent growth in 2003.
